The Future of Work on Labor Day 2023: Celebrating and Reflecting on the Changing Landscape of Labor

Introduction

Labor Day, a holiday deeply rooted in the history of the United States, serves as a moment of reflection on the progress made by workers and the challenges that lie ahead. On this Labor Day in 2023, as we celebrate the contributions of workers, it is crucial to recognize that the future of work is undergoing a profound transformation. The advancements in technology, automation, and artificial intelligence are reshaping industries and raising important questions about the nature of work in the coming years.

The Changing World of Work

The world of work has always evolved, adapting to the demands of economies, societies, and technological advancements. However, the pace and the scale of change we are currently witnessing are unprecedented. Automation and artificial intelligence are rapidly altering traditional job structures, leading to the displacement of certain roles while creating opportunities in emerging industries.

This shift in the labor landscape carries both promise and peril for workers. On one hand, automation has the potential to streamline processes, enhance productivity, and create new jobs. On the other hand, it can also lead to job losses, wage stagnation, and growing income inequality. Balancing these competing interests is a complex challenge that requires careful consideration and forward-thinking policies.

A Philosophical Perspective: The Value of Work

Labor Day offers an opportunity not only to discuss the practical implications of the future of work but also to reflect on the deeper philosophical questions it raises. What is the value of work in our lives? How does work contribute to our sense of purpose and identity? These existential inquiries become increasingly relevant as the nature of work undergoes fundamental changes.

Work has historically been a source of dignity, social cohesion, and economic stability. It has provided individuals with a sense of purpose and belonging, while also offering the means to support themselves and their families. As the future of work unfolds, it is important to ensure that these fundamental aspects are not lost in the pursuit of efficiency and profit.

Maximizing Human Potential

In envisioning the future of work, it is essential to prioritize the maximization of human potential. While technology can augment our abilities, it is the unique qualities and skills of individuals that will continue to drive innovation, creativity, and empathy.

To achieve this, investments in education and lifelong learning are imperative. Equipping individuals with adaptable skills that complement technological advancements is key to ensuring they can navigate the changing labor landscape. Additionally, providing support for workers in industries vulnerable to automation and displacement is crucial to ensure a fair and just transition.

The Role of Government and Business

Addressing the challenges and harnessing the opportunities of the future of work requires a collaborative effort between government, businesses, and workers. Government policies must prioritize the safeguarding of workers’ rights, establishing fair labor practices, and ensuring a social safety net that provides support and security to all individuals.

Businesses, too, have a role to play in shaping the future of work. Responsible employers need to invest in skills development, provide equitable wages, and create workplaces that foster inclusivity and work-life balance. Embracing automation and technological advancements must be done in a manner that considers the well-being and livelihoods of workers.
